The runway at Hunter Army Airfield, stretching 11,375 feet, has served over the decades - in times of peace and in times of war - as the takeoff and landing place for America's defenders. On June 21, the 5K/10K Flightline "Dirty Up" Run event will give military and civilians alike an opportunity to walk or run on the expansive runway, get an up close look at military aircraft on display, and hang out with those who fly and maintain the aircraft.
